#a32921 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#a32921 is composed of 63.9% red, 16.1% green and 12.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 74.8% magenta, 79.8% yellow and 36.1% black. It has a hue angle of 3.7 degrees, a saturation of 66.3% and a lightness of 38.4%. #a32921 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ff5242 with #470000. Closest websafe color is: #993333.

#a32921 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#a32921 has RGB values of R:163, G:41, B:33 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.75, Y:0.8, K:0.36. Its decimal value is 10692897.

Shades and Tints of #a32921

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#100403 is the darkest color, while #ffffff is the lightest one.

Tones of #a32921

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#675e5d is the less saturated color, while #c10f03 is the most saturated one.
